2,3,6-Trimethylphenol
2,3,6 TMP is an intermediate for synthetic vitamin E, antioxidants, and plastics.
30, 37, 40, 48, 122, 211
2,4-Di-tert-Amylphenol
2,4 DTAP is an intermediate for UV stabilizers, photographic developers, specialty surfactants, and fuel additive intermediates.
6, 34, 37, 39, 48, 122, 211, 212
2,4-Xylenol
2,4-Xylenol is an intermediate for antioxidants, stabilizers, pressure-sensitive inks, and photoresists.
6, 37, 39, 48, 122, 211
3, 3, 5-TRIMETHYLCYCLOHEXANONE
TMCON is used as a raw material for chemical syntheses e.g. monomer for specialty polycarbonate (Apec®); peroxides used as polymerization initiator. It is also used in coatings and paints to provide improved levelling, gloss, and surface finish.

BRJ-473 is a thermosetting phenolic resin used primarily in the formulation of nitrile rubber (NBR) adhesives. BRJ-473 is phenolic resole resin supplied in solution in methyl-ethyl-ketone for solvent-based adhesives.
14, 34, 37, 39, 43, 54, 92, 96, 116, 125
CRJ-418
CRJ-418 is a thermoplastic alkylphenol resin and is supplied in flaked form. Primarily used as a tackifier in NR and SBR-based rubber compounds and several splice cement applications in tires and technical rubber goods.
28, 37, 39, 54, 96, 111, 116, 118, 125
CRJ-706
CRJ-706 is a modified phenolic resin in powdered form, novolac type which contain hexamethylenetetramine used for rubber reinforcing and other applications.
24, 37, 54, 116, 118, 125
DURAZONE™ 37 FLAKE
DURAZONE™ 37 antiozonant is an antioxidant and an antiozonant that is added into rubber in quantities of 2 to 4 parts per 100 parts RHC. DURAZONE™ 37 antiozonant is a non-staining antiozonant offering superior static ozone protection, excellent dynamic protection and excellent antioxidant protection. DURAZONE™ 37 antiozonant will not migrate and stain from a black compound to a white compound adjacent to it.

ELAZTOBOND™ A220 is a modified resorcinol-formaldehyde resin and is supplied in flaked form. ELAZTOBOND™ A220 is designed to replace standard resorcinol formaldehyde resins that are added to rubber compounds to promote rubber to metal adhesion. Free resorcinol below 0.5%.
10, 37, 54, 64, 116, 118, 125
ELAZTOBOND™ A250
ELAZTOBOND™ A250 is a modified resorcinol-formaldehyde resin and is supplied in flaked form. ELAZTOBOND™ A250 is designed to replace standard resorcinol formaldehyde resins that are added to rubber compounds to promote rubber to metal adhesion. Free resorcinol below 0.5%.
10, 37, 54, 64, 116, 118, 125
ELAZTOBOND™ A250LP
ELAZTOBOND™ A250LP is a modified resorcinol-formaldehyde resin and is supplied in flaked form. ELAZTOBOND™ A250LP is designed to replace standard resorcinol formaldehyde resins that are added to rubber compounds to promote rubber to metal adhesion. Free resorcinol below 0.5% and free phenol below 1.0%.
10, 37, 54, 64, 116, 118, 125
ELAZTOBOND™ C750
ELAZTOBOND™C750 is an alkylphenol-formaldehyde resin used for curing rubber compounds. ELAZTOBOND™ C750 is used as a curing resin in rubbers such as Butyl (IIR), EPDM, and NBR.
14, 37, 39, 64, 92, 96, 111, 116, 125, 147
ELAZTOBOND™ E125
ELAZTOBOND™ E125 is an eco-friendly resin developed as a high performance grip resin enhancer for tread. ELAZTOBOND™ E125 enables tire compounders to optimize treads for improved wet and snow grip with no loss in rolling resistance performance.
28, 37, 54, 64, 116, 118, 125
ELAZTOBOND™ MeltPlus T8 7920
ELAZTOBOND™ MeltPlus T8 7920 is a bio-renewable-based tackifier that delivers enhanced adhesion performance in both pressure sensitive and conventional ethylene vinyl acetate (EVA) hot melt adhesives
10, 28, 33, 34, 37, 38, 48, 50, 51, 54, 64, 92, 157, 230
ELAZTOBOND™ T6000
ELAZTOBOND™ T6000 is a modified alkylphenol resin. ELAZTOBOND™ T6000 is a high performance tackifier for use in rubber compounds where a high level of tack is required. It has superior initial and aged tack retention and improved scorch safety allowing for broader processing conditions. Super-Tackifier resin for rubber compounds.
28, 37, 39, 54, 64, 116, 118, 125
ELAZTOBOND™-B8-3410
ELAZTOBOND™ B8-3410 resin is based on bio-renewable materials and is resorcinol-free, making it a more sustainable and safer solution than traditional bonding resins used in the rubber industry. In addition to its improved safety profile, ELAZTOBOND™ B8-3410 has shown to offer comparable or better performance than resorcinol containing resins in aged and unaged testing.

ETHAPHOS™ 368 antioxidant is a phosphite processing stabilizer with good hydrolytic stability. It is approved by the FDA for use in indirect food contact applications, and can be used in combination with phenolic antioxidants, acid neutralizers, UV stabilizers, and other functional additives.

POLYBOND™ 1001N polymer modifier is a chemically modified PP. Features chemical coupling agent for glass and mica-filled polypropylene systems. Offers good adhesion to many substrates including aluminum and stainless steel. Adhesive for aluminum to aluminum and steel to steel laminates.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 1002
POLYBOND™ 1002 polymer modifier is a chemically modified PP. Features chemical coupling agent for glass and mica-filled polypropylene systems, offers good adhesion to many substrates including aluminum and stainless steel. Adhesive for aluminum to aluminum and steel to steel laminates.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 1009
POLYBOND™ 1009 polymer modifier is a chemically modified PE. It can be applied as a coupling agent for glass and mica-reinforced polyethylene and provides good adhesion to a variety of substances including aluminum, stainless steel, and tin-plated steel.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 1103
POLYBOND™ 1103 polymer modifier is a new chemically modified PP. Features high-flow acrylic acid grafted polypropylene for processes and applications requiring very low melt viscosity acrylic acid content equivalent to standard POLYBOND™ polymer modifier acrylic acid types (POLYBOND™ 1001 and POLYBOND™ 1002 polymer modifiers). Available in pellet form.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3000
POLYBOND™ 3000 polymer modifier is a chemically modified PP. Applications include chemical coupling agent for glass fiber, cellulose fiber, and mineral filler reinforced PP which provides enhanced physical and thermal properties. High level of functionality allows for low addition levels as well as low viscosity for excellent dispersion. Compatibilizer for polymer blends with polar polymers such as polyamides and EVOH Adhesion promoter with substrates such as aluminum, stainless steel, and polyp
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3002
POLYBOND™ 3002 polymer modifier is a chemically modified PP. Chemical coupling agent for glass fiber, cellulose fiber, and mineral filler reinforced PP that provides enhanced physical and thermal properties. Compatibilizer for blends such as polypropylene/polyamide and polypropylene/EVOH to improve processability and mechanical properties. Processing on any conventional thermoplastic processing equipment is feasible. Stabilized for both processing and long-term heat aging resistance.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3009
POLYBOND™ 3009 polymer modifier is a chemically modified PE. Applications include chemical coupling agent for glass fiber, cellulose fiber, and mineral filler reinforced PE that provides enhanced physical and thermal properties. Compatibilizer for polymer alloys of polyethylene and polar polymers, such as polyamides, to give improved processability and mechanical properties. Offers good adhesion to a wide variety of substrates including aluminum and stainless steel.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3029
POLYBOND™ 3029 polymer modifier is specifically designed for use in wood and natural fiber-filled polyethylene composites. Compared with general purpose grades of coupling agents, it provides improved tensile, flexural, and impact strengths as well as lower water absorption.
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3150
POLYBOND™ 3150 polymer modifier is a chemically modified PP. It features a chemical coupling agent for glass fiber, cellulose fiber, and mineral filler reinforced PP that provides enhanced physical and thermal properties. Compatibilizer for blends such as polypropylene/polyamide and polypropylene/EVOH to improve processability and mechanical properties. Processing on any conventional thermoplastic processing equipment is feasible. Stabilized for both processing and long-term heat aging resistanc
13, 37, 39, 48, 79, 92, 99, 117, 215, 217
POLYBOND™ 3200
POLYBOND™ 3200 polymer modifier is a chemically modified PP. It features a chemical coupling agent for glass fiber, cellulose fiber and mineral filler reinforced PP that provides enhanced physical and thermal properties. Compatibilizer for blends such as polypropylene/polyamide and polypropylene/EVOH to improve processability and mechanical properties. Physical properties comparable to other POLYBOND™ polymer modifier products can be obtained using lower addition levels.

SP-1044 resin cures butyl rubber, because of its versatility and inherent ozone resistance, has been employed in many areas including tire curing bladders, conveyor belts, gaskets, pressure-sensitive adhesives, and heat-resistant packing compounds. In addition, these vulcanizates are non-blooming, non-staining and have high modulus values. SP-1044 resin can be used in inks, paints, and coatings.
14, 33, 37, 48, 51, 54, 92, 96, 111, 116, 118, 125, 147, 161, 218
SP-1045
SP-1045 is a reactive alkylphenol resin and is supplied in flake form. SP-1045 resin cures butyl rubber. Because of its versatility and inherent ozone resistance, it has been employed in many areas including tire curing bladders, conveyor belts, gaskets, pressure sensitive adhesives, and heat-resistant packing compounds. In addition, these vulcanizates are non-blooming, non-staining, and have high modulus values. SP-1045 resin can be used in inks, paints, and coatings.
14, 33, 37, 48, 51, 54, 92, 96, 111, 116, 118, 125, 147, 158, 161, 218
SP-1045H
SP-1045H is a reactive alkylphenol resin and is supplied in flake form. SP-1045H resin cures butyl rubber. Because of its versatility and inherent ozone resistance, it has been employed in many areas including tire curing bladders, conveyor belts, gaskets, pressure-sensitive adhesives, and heat-resistant packing compounds. In addition, these vulcanizates are non-blooming, non-staining, and have high modulus values. SP-1045H resin can be used in inks, paints, and coatings.
14, 33, 37, 51, 54, 92, 96, 111, 116, 118, 125, 218
SP-1045P
SP-1045P is a reactive alkylphenol resin and is supplied in pastille form. SP-1045P resin cures butyl rubber. Because of its versatility and inherent ozone resistance, it has been employed in many areas including tire curing bladders, conveyor belts, gaskets, pressure-sensitive adhesives, and heat-resistant packing compounds. In addition, these vulcanizates are non-blooming, non-staining, and have high modulus values. SP-1045P resin can be used in inks, paints, and coatings.
14, 33, 37, 51, 54, 92, 96, 111, 116, 118, 125, 158, 218
SP-1055
SP-1055 is a reactive brominated alkylphenolic resin with methylol groups used to cure rubber. The use of brominated resins in compounding is especially effective when the rubber may be exposed to heat or repeated use. Rubbers compounded with SP-1055 exhibit exceptional scorch safety, high-temperature stability, and excellent dynamic properties. SP-1055 resin can be used to cure rubber-based pressure-sensitive adhesives (masking, duct, splicing tapes, etc.).
14, 33, 37, 51, 54, 92, 116, 118, 125, 218
SP-1056
SP-1056 is a reactive brominated alkylphenolic resin with methylol groups and high bromine content used to cure rubber. The use of brominated resins in compounding is especially effective when the rubber may be exposed to heat or repeated use. Rubbers compounded with SP-1056 exhibit good scorch safety, high-temperature stability, and excellent dynamic properties. SP-1056 resin can be used to cure rubber-based pressure sensitive adhesives (masking, duct, splicing tapes, etc.).
